Feldenkrais® and Contemporary Dance Workshop. Saturday at 10am for 2.5hrs. Open to everyone, all ages invited and no experience required.


The workshop

Experience a deep dive into movement practice delivered by experts in Feldenkrais and contemporary dance. This workshop will lead you through a class of Awareness Through Movement (Feldenkrais), a method of somatic education.

Followed by a movement class built on contemporary dance and improvisation techniques. Together we will disassemble old and unhelpful habits in order to find new ways of moving, feeling and being.

Guided by:

Tobiah Booth-Remmers

My movement and teaching practice has been distilled across the length of my career, integrating a vast range of influences from different methodologies and techniques, all centred on contemporary dance.

My practice is driven by a curiosity for how we experience movement through our own individual body, and how this can lead us to grow and understand ourselves physically and emotionally.

Juan Pedro Maciel

My work brings together two complementary disciplines into a single, coherent movement ecosystem that draws on Feldenkrais and Capoeira Angola.

Feldenkrais provides the foundation of awareness and kindness, allowing the nervous system to reach new horizons. What I love most about the Feldenkrais® Method is that it creates a space for people to nurture a deeper, kinder bond with themselves. From there we blossom into movement. Capoeira Angola, my life long practice, adds the dimensions of dance, musicality, and joyful connection with others.
